Transaction 75c16c88f5d80a4e5408cb79b4fa76e3e36b429d005a48e988a46509ee83fc5e
2 Input
2 Outputs
- 75c16c88f5d80a4e5408cb79b4fa76e3e36b429d005a48e988a46509ee83fc5e:0
- 75c16c88f5d80a4e5408cb79b4fa76e3e36b429d005a48e988a46509ee83fc5e:1
value 169100
address 1DfhUxW3PvpKxJrFLVzBtsKN3NdJMV9Zhd
value 2330000
address 3BFHiP6y9aK8Ek1Gu51KVAwyHxDpMmRaym